I scanned my CT this month for the annual HU verification.  I borrowed the Ti plug (had not done in a couple years and last time I had it was not using Pylinac).  Plug 8 was the Ti.  As you can see the program just uses the normal size plug to analyze and I got a results with a large SD.

I just measured with tools on CT and in TPS.  Just thought I point it out for others.

Hi Stephen,

the analyze function has an option that lets you scale the roi size:
That way you can adjust for the thinner Ti rod.

If you only want to use the small roi diameter for the Ti you have the option to define your own Phantom with roi diameters for each individual insert:
